What I Look for in Wireless Range
For me, the most important factor is the actual range. Some mice advertise long range performance, but in real use, the signal can weaken quickly. I always check whether the mouse uses Bluetooth or a USB receiver, because that affects how far and how stable the connection feels. If I need better distance and consistency, I usually prefer a dedicated wireless receiver.
Connection Stability Matters to Me
A long range mouse is only useful if it stays connected. I pay attention to how often the mouse drops connection or lags. In my experience, a stable connection is more valuable than just a big range number on the box. I want a mouse that responds instantly, especially when I am using it for work or presentations.
Battery Life Is a Big Deal
I do not want to keep charging my mouse all the time. That is why battery life is one of the first things I check. A good long range wireless mouse should last for weeks or even months, depending on use. I also like it when the mouse has an easy battery indicator, so I am not caught off guard.
Comfort and Grip Shape
Since I may use my mouse for hours, comfort is very important to me. I look for a shape that fits my hand naturally. If the mouse feels too small, too flat, or too heavy, I notice it right away. I prefer a design that supports my hand well and reduces strain during long sessions.
Sensor Performance and Accuracy
I always consider how accurate the mouse feels on different surfaces. A strong sensor helps me move smoothly and click precisely. If I plan to use the mouse on a desk, table, or even a laptop sleeve in a pinch, I want it to track well without skipping.
Portability and Size
If I travel often, I like a mouse that is easy to carry. A compact long range wireless mouse fits nicely into my bag and is convenient for mobile work. At the same time, I do not want to sacrifice comfort just to get a smaller size, so I try to balance portability with usability.
Extra Features I Find Useful
I also look at bonus features that make the mouse more practical. Silent clicks, programmable buttons, adjustable DPI, and multi-device pairing can all be helpful. I especially appreciate features that make my workflow faster or more comfortable without adding unnecessary complexity.
Compatibility Is Important
Before I buy, I make sure the mouse works with my devices. I check if it supports Windows, macOS, Linux, or tablets, depending on what I use most. A mouse may have great range, but if it is not compatible with my setup, it is not the right choice for me.
